During her 25 years in the education field, Maria Fabyonic has witnessed firsthand how teachers can profoundly impact a student's life. In response to the ongoing teacher shortage, Pittsburgh Public Schools has launched a new teacher preparation program aimed at attracting and training future educators. This initiative seeks to address the critical need for qualified teachers in the district and enhance the quality of education for students.
The program is designed to provide aspiring teachers with the skills and knowledge necessary to succeed in the classroom. Participants will receive comprehensive training, mentorship, and practical experience, ensuring they are well-equipped to meet the challenges of modern education. Fabyonic emphasized the importance of nurturing new talent in the teaching profession, highlighting that effective educators can inspire and motivate students to reach their full potential.
As schools across the nation grapple with staffing shortages, Pittsburgh's proactive approach reflects a commitment to fostering a new generation of dedicated educators. This program not only aims to fill vacancies but also to cultivate a supportive community for both teachers and students alike.
